Ms Windows

Fixing Windows Insider Issues on Windows 10: Troubleshooting Guide

If you are experiencing issues with the Windows Insider Program not working in Windows 10, you are not alone. This problem can arise due to several reasons, including configuration errors, software conflicts, network issues, or even outdated operating systems. Understanding the underlying causes and available solutions can help restore the Windows Insider experience on your device.


Key Takeaways

  • The Windows Insider Program may not function correctly in Windows 10 due to various issues.
  • Common causes include outdated software, misconfigured settings, and network problems.
  • Effective troubleshooting steps can resolve the issue, such as checking for updates, modifying settings, and using command-line tools.

Overview of the Problem

The Windows Insider Program allows users to access beta builds of Windows before their public release, enabling testers to explore new features and share feedback with Microsoft. However, when the program doesn’t work as intended on Windows 10, it can be frustrating. Users might face issues ranging from being unable to opt into insider channels to facing errors during updates.

See also  Fix Windows 10 Administrator Account Issues: Solutions for Login Problems

Possible Causes

Several issues could lead to the Windows Insider Program not functioning properly on Windows 10:

  1. Outdated Software: Your Windows 10 installation might not be up to date, which can prevent participation in the Insider Program.

  2. Network Issues: A slow or unstable internet connection might disrupt the connection between your device and Microsoft servers.

  3. Misconfigured Settings: Incorrect configurations within Windows settings may prevent the Insiders Program from functioning as intended.

  4. system errors: Corrupted files or system settings may hinder the functioning of the Insider Program.


Step-by-Step Troubleshooting Guide

Step 1: Check for Windows Updates

  1. Open Settings by pressing Windows + I.
  2. Navigate to Update & Security.
  3. Click on Windows Update and then select Check for updates.
  4. Install any available updates and restart your machine.

Step 2: Verify Insider Settings

  1. Go to SettingsUpdate & SecurityWindows Insider Program.
  2. Ensure you are signed in with your Microsoft account.
  3. Check that you are in the desired Insider channel (Canary, Dev, Beta, or Release Preview).

Step 3: network connectivity Check

  1. Ensure you have a stable internet connection.
  2. Try using a wired connection instead of Wi-Fi for better reliability.
  3. Open a browser and check if you can access Microsoft’s website without issues.

Step 4: Use Command-Line Tools for Repair

  1. Open Command Prompt as an administrator:

    • Search for “cmd” in the Start Menu, right-click, and select Run as administrator.
  2. Type the following commands and press Enter after each:
    bash
    sfc /scannow
    dism.exe /Online /Cleanup-image /Restorehealth

  3. Wait for the process to complete and then restart your computer.

Step 5: Reset Windows Update Components

  1. Open the Command Prompt as an administrator.
  2. Type the following commands, pressing Enter after each:
    bash
    net stop wuauserv
    net stop cryptSvc
    net stop bits
    net stop msiserver
    net start wuauserv
    net start cryptSvc
    net start bits
    net start msiserver
See also  Fixing Issues: Paint Not Working in Windows 10 - Troubleshooting Guide

Common Mistakes and How to Avoid Them

  • Skipping Updates: Make sure to regularly check for system updates. Skipping crucial updates can cause compatibility issues.
  • Incorrect Account: Ensure you are logged in with the correct Microsoft account associated with the Insider Program.
  • Poor Network Management: Always verify your network connection before attempting updates or changes in settings.

Prevention Tips / Best Practices

  1. Regularly Maintain Your System: Run system maintenance checks and uninstall unused applications.
  2. Back Up Important Files: Regular backups can save you from data loss in case of a deeper system failure.
  3. Join the Insider Program at Initial Release: Engage with the Insider Program promptly after your OS is updated to reduce issues with early update inheritance.

Cause / Solution Quick Reference

CauseSolution
Outdated Windows softwareUpdate Windows via the Settings menu
Network connectivity issuesCheck your internet connection and use a wired connection
Misconfigured SettingsVerify settings in the Insider Program in Windows settings
Corrupted system filesUse SFC / DISM commands to repair system files

Frequently Asked Questions

What should I do if the Windows Insider Program fails to start?

Ensure that you are using the latest version of Windows 10 and check your network connection. Then, follow the troubleshooting steps outlined above.

Can I still use Windows 10 if I cannot access the Insider Program?

Yes, Windows 10 will continue to function normally. However, you will miss out on beta features available through the Insider Program.

How do I opt out of the Windows Insider Program?

Go to SettingsUpdate & SecurityWindows Insider Program, and select the option to stop receiving Insider builds.

See also  Fix Windows 10 Driver Installation Issues: Step-by-Step Solutions

Will my data be affected if I reset Windows components?

Resetting Windows Update components typically won’t harm your personal data, but it’s always wise to back up important files when performing system operations.

Is it possible to join the Insider Program in Windows 10 after October 14, 2025?

While Windows 10 will still function after the end date, you may be encouraged to upgrade to Windows 11 to ensure compatibility with future Insider builds.


In conclusion, if you are encountering difficulties with the Windows Insider Program not working in Windows 10, following systematic troubleshooting steps can often resolve the issues. Paying attention to common mistakes and practicing preventive measures can enhance your experience with the program.

About the author

Jeffrey Collins

Jeffrey Collins

Jeffery Collins is a Microsoft Office specialist with over 15 years of experience in teaching, training, and business consulting. He has guided thousands of students and professionals in mastering Office applications such as Excel, Word, PowerPoint, and Outlook. From advanced Excel functions and VBA automation to professional Word formatting, data-driven PowerPoint presentations, and efficient email management in Outlook, Jeffery is passionate about making Office tools practical and accessible. On Softwers, he shares step-by-step guides, troubleshooting tips, and expert insights to help users unlock the full potential of Microsoft Office.